Physical and chemical properties of 943552-31-6

Exact Mass

316.95300

LogP

0.17550

Melting Point

151-156℃

Molecular Formula

C9H9BBrNO4S

Molecular Weight

317.95200

PSA

84.08000

Storage condition

2-8℃

Applications of 943552-31-6

5-Bromo-2-thiophenylboronic acid MIDA ester finds applications primarily in organic synthesis:

  • Cross-coupling reactions: It serves as a valuable building block in Suzuki-Miyaura cross-coupling reactions for the synthesis of complex organic molecules, including pharmaceuticals and materials science precursors.
  • Heterocycle synthesis: The compound can be used to introduce thiophene moieties into larger molecular structures, which is particularly useful in the development of organic electronic materials.
  • Iterative cross-coupling: The stability of the MIDA ester allows for selective cross-coupling reactions, enabling the synthesis of complex polyaromatic compounds through iterative coupling steps.
